Spring is upon us - not that you'd know it from the cold, wet and miserable weather! This is the time of year when garden bird numbers soar as fledglings appear en masse.

This is also the most critical time of year to offer quality, easy-to-digest bird food (especially if the weather is inclement and the insect population is low, which is certainly the case right now).
